We believe therapy should be accessible, inclusive, and rooted in thoughtful, high-quality care. Our Affordable Care Program is designed to support individuals and couples who are seeking meaningful therapy at a reduced rate, without compromising safety, depth, or professionalism.

One way we make this possible is by offering therapy with graduate-level student clinicians who are nearing completion of their master’s degrees in counseling, social work, or psychology. These therapists bring curiosity, care, and strong clinical training, along with a deep commitment to serving clients who may otherwise have difficulty accessing therapy.

Supported, Supervised Care

Our interns are carefully selected through a competitive application process and receive ongoing support throughout their time at Insight, including:

  • Weekly supervision with an experienced, licensed supervisor

  • Ongoing training in evidence-based and trauma-informed care

  • Direct observation of clinical work through live sessions and video review

This model allows you to work closely with a dedicated therapist while also benefiting from the guidance and oversight of a seasoned clinician supporting their work behind the scenes.

What to Expect

Because supervision is an essential part of our training model, clients working with interns agree to have sessions recorded for supervision purposes. All recordings are confidential, securely stored, and used only for clinical training. We are happy to answer any questions about this process and ensure you feel comfortable moving forward.

Cost & Availability

We’d love to help you access supportive, affordable care. Graduate Intern sessions begin at $95 for 50 minutes, and we intentionally hold several sliding-scale spots for clients who may benefit from a lower rate, based on need and availability.
